United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is seeking a Senior Test Design Engineer to join their transformative team in Titchfield, England. The role focuses on leading the design and implementation of test rigs within the innovative aerospace sector, particularly for aircraft fuel systems.
The ideal candidate will have significant experience in test rig and fixture design, mechanical engineering principles, and a strong problem-solving mindset.
The position offers a competitive compensation package with various benefits including 25 days holiday plus bank holidays.
